About The Position

This position is a regulatory position. Work in a regulatory capacity and ensure the racino is following rules, regulations, laws and standard operating procedures. Ensure racino operations comply with all statutory and administrative provisions. Respond to incidents occurring on site, complete reports and maintain a compliance database for reports of suspicious activity, unusual incidents, and all other reportable incidents. Complete background investigations on racino employees. Facilitate the licensing process for racino gaming employees. Provide exceptional customer service to patrons and racino staff. Congratulate jackpot winners. Observe Intercept process for winners and create Intercept Accounts. Assist patrons enroll in the Time Out Ohio Program and provide program information. Use surveillance equipment and ensure proper surveillance coverage of all Video Lottery Terminals in the racino facility. Monitor the floor Drop and ensure compliance with established procedure. Monitor all Video Lottery Terminal floor moves and ensure compliance with established procedure. Receive incoming Video Lottery Terminals and verify shipping security seals, serial numbers, description of the machines, and manufacturer name. Verify Video Lottery Terminals to be removed and confirm manufacturer name and serial number. Work as a team player to assist the team in completing its goals and objectives. Learn to use Lottery-specific software applications for daily job responsibilities. Work in a location that is open 24 hours per day/7 days per week.
